373590 2005-07-19 22:36:00 Anyone got any suggestions or know of any free/ shareware to try and recover data from a HDD that was reloaded in error.
Was Win 2000 and I believe load process that was used quick formats the HDD before reloading it . It is running Win 2000 again on new load.
I know the reload will have over written some data on the HDD but I am hoping some of the old data may be recovereable
Can you help?
nivag (8551)
373591 2005-07-19 23:42:00 Try PC Inspector File Recovery (www.pcinspector.de). Download it to a different PC or at least a different drive to that you want to recover from.

The less you access the drive, the greater your chances of recovery. Good luck.
